Why they chose this property

This property is a replica of a traditional Navajo Native American home. It is modernized with all of todays needs. Once you step inside of our Hogan you can picture what it would be like to live in a traditional Hogan. A Hogan is a hexagon building with no indoor plumbing or electricity. It would have a wood burning stove in the center of the room used for cooking and heating. Lucky for yo,u we have indoor plumbing as well as heat and air and a kitchenette furnished with a range, small refrigerator and microwave. Our hogan also has a washer and dryer inside the unit.
